    To Major-General Halleck, General-in-Chief: Generals ORD and HURLBERT came upon the enemy yesterday, and General HURLBERT having driven in small bodies of the rebels the day before, after seven hours' hard fighting, drove the enemy five miles back across the Hatchie towards Corinth, capturing two batteries, about three hundred prisoners, and many small arms. I immediately apprised Gen. ROSECRANS of these facts, and directed him to urge on the good work. The following dispatch has just been received from him: CHEVALLA, Oct. 6, 1862. To Major-Gen. Grant: The enemy are totally routed, throwing everything away. We are following sharply. W.S....

    Japanese knotweed evolved in one of the harshest environments on Earth – now scientists are desperately trying to find a way to destroy it. Where it does produce seeds, Japanese knotweed is prolific. At one research site in Philadelphia, the plants were found to produce up to 150,000 seeds each year per stem – most of which were found to be viable. This two-part system, with above-ground and below-ground body parts, means it's extremely difficult to control Japanese knotweed with chemicals.
